FAQ's of BSE-0150 Leak Test Apparatus:


Q: How does the BSE-0150 Leak Test Apparatus operate?

A: The apparatus uses a hand-operated vacuum pump to create negative pressure in its chamber, applying either the bubble emission test or vacuum leak test to evaluate the integrity of blisters, strips, ampoules, and vials.

Q: What safety features are included in this equipment?

A: The BSE-0150 is equipped with an over-temperature protection system and a pressure release valve, providing reliable safety during operation and preventing accidental over-pressurization.

Q: Where is the BSE-0150 commonly used?

A: This device is suitable for use in pharmaceutical quality control labs, R&D laboratories, and production facilities that need to verify packaging integrity in compliance with GMP/GLP standards.

Q: What is the process for conducting a leak test with this apparatus?

A: Samples are placed in the transparent chamber, the vacuum is applied using the manual pump, and leaks are detected by monitoring for bubble emissions or pressure changes as per the specified test method.

Q: What benefits does the silicon gasket lid provide?

A: The silicon gasket lid ensures an airtight seal during testing, which enhances the accuracy and consistency of leak detection across repeated tests.

Q: When should I use the manual mode versus the timer-based control mode?

A: Manual mode offers hands-on control over test duration, while the timer-based mode is optimal for repeatable testing according to set laboratory protocols or standardized methods.
